Изменить стиль страницы

В обычный день Дим не задумываясь бы отложил инструменты и постарался побыстрее поесть, отвлечься и уснуть, но не сегодня. Сегодня они опаздывали, и от синдрома «кроличьей норы» Дим видел прямую пользу, которая не даст послезавтра утром пустить его на органы, плазму и крововосстанавливающие препараты.

Блоки сенсоров, расположенные на корпусе боевого бота, аналогичны электродам на экзокостюме мех-пехоты. Движения бота и пилота синхронизированы благодаря механической системе из десантного модуля. Вот и весь нехитрый план.

Но, как говорилось во времена до Последней войны, «гладко было на бумаге, да забыли про овраги». Такие, казалось бы, бесполезные присказки из прошлого Дим узнал благодаря одной из, казалось бы, бесполезных инфокарт. Всего пятьсот очков социальной значимости и Дим обогатил свой кругозор знаниями веков, заключёнными в короткие, ёмкие и запоминающиеся присказки.

Теперь эти самые «овраги» Диму придется зарыть вручную, да так, чтобы ни одна «болячка» боевого бота не вылезла в момент эксплуатации. Модуль экзоскелета просто не имел «мозгов», лишь чип, в котором на самой плате была «забита» последовательность команд при том или ином движении мех-пехотинца. Диму же предстояло синхронизировать боевого бота, весом в пятьсот тонн, и семидесятикилограммовое тело человека.

Экзоскелет больше не требовал простоты электронной начинки, так как находился внутри двух кабин, каждую из которых вполне можно изолировать от электромагнитного излучения хоть тем же свинцом. Реакторы боевого бота и не заметят лишней тонны нагрузки.

Вот и настало время тех самых рабочих костылей: выдернув модуль управления из экзоскелета, Дим положил его перед собой, как образец. Сверяясь с ним, он начал распаивать на макетную плату провода от электродов, считывающих мышечные движения с тела мех-пехотинца. Теперь уже сверху на макетную плату был установлен внешний жесткий диск и две аккумуляторные батареи на кремниевых нанопроводах. Такие, если не использовать бот в боевом режиме, будут поддерживать систему в рабочем положении лет семьдесят. Энергонакопители, использованные Димом, лет тридцать никому не нужным хламом пылились в арсенале Черного утеса, так почему бы им еще разок не послужить во благо доминиона?

Дальше пошла работа с нуля: опираясь на знания, полученные благодаря нейроинсталляции инфокарт по роботостроению, Дим досконально знал архитектуру программного кода ботов до пятого поколения. Чтобы избежать конфликта систем, он взял ее, как основу, для написания новой системы под центр управления экзокостюмом.

Последующие несколько часов Дим только и делал, что выделял и стирал, удалял и стирал, целые пласты мусорного текста, абсолютно не нужных команд и откровенно конфликтующих между собой скриптов. Когда обновленная система была инсталлированна в центры управления Шерхана, Дим не удержался и запустил пробную симуляцию. Время отклика удалось уменьшить до четырех миллисекунд, оставив архаичные цифры в семнадцать-двадцать шесть миллисекунд в прошлом.

Пришёл невыспавшийся, но невероятно мотивированный Ром. Её он приобрёл после встречи с Владом Ражом. Десантник мотивировать умел, очевидно, и перебинтованные руки с мозолями у Рома по его милости.

Так как знания у Рома были, в основном, по механике и ремонту боевых ботов, а с электрикой и электронной начинкой он не связывался, Дим озадачил его установкой кресла для второго пилота, а также попросил приступить к изоляции свинцом кабины пилотов. Рос Пер дал четко понять, что при испытаниях новой системы оба инженера-механика обязаны присутствовать внутри своего детища.

Осталось двадцать шесть часов до «часа Х». Размяв пальцы, Дим перехватил из принесенного Ромом пайка с напитком энергетический батончик, запил его растворимым витамином с ароматом вишни и углубился в написание адаптированного кода.

Потерев красные от недосыпа и усталости глаза, Дим поставил скобку, закрывающую последний скрипт. Он сделал всё, что мог, а до испытания осталось меньше полутора часов. Даже если он где-то ошибся, времени исправлять уже не будет. За предыдущие сутки ему удалось поспать всего дважды по два часа. Ром Лерм управился гораздо быстрее него и, видя измученное состояние своего напарника, настоял на пусть кратковременном, но сне, а когда тот не желал отрываться от написания кода даже на пять минут, кормил его с ложки.

— Запусти его, — вымученно улыбнулся Дим. — Хоть посмотрим перед тем, как выкатывать перед Легатом.

— Я? — недоуменно ткнул себя пальцем в грудь Ром Лерм.

— Да, тебе же всё равно пилотировать этот бот. Ты забыл слова Рос Пера — нам придется пилотировать Шерхана. Я никогда не сидел в нейрокресле и уж тем более не пилотировал ни десантный модуль, ни экзоскелет мех-пехоты. А ты, неплохой мех-пехотинец.

— Откуда ты знаешь? — осторожно поинтересовался Ром.

Дим замялся, поняв, что узнал какую-то вещь, которую Ром считал тайной. Придумывать приходилось буквально на ходу.

— Ты посмотри на себя, вес далеко за сотню килограмм, и всё это — мышцы. Так что по комплекции ты идеально подходишь даже под мех-десантника, не говоря уже про пехоту. Во-вторых, когда в медблок я как-то раз пришёл с тобой, на тебе был комбинезон мех-пехотинцев, значит, как минимум, с основами управления ты уже знаком, вот я и сделал выводы.

— Правильные выводы, — Кажется «съел» отговорку Ром. А потом улыбнувшись спросил с азартом детского огонька в глазах. — Как считаешь, у нас получилось?

— Я же говорю, давай проверим? — ответил на улыбку Дим.

Ром вскарабкался по боту, будто и не было бессонной ночи полной нервов и работы. Люк кабины с шипением закрылся, загорелись стартовые огни на корпусе Шерхана, загудели реакторы и……Ничего.

Реакторы гудели, выдавая мощность, но бот стоял, так и оставаясь безжизненным колоссом. Система работала, но, непонятно по какой причине, бот не желал повиноваться командам пилота и двигаться. Когда напарник выбрался из кабины и спустился вниз, Дим едва ли того узнал. Ром Лерм, казалось, за эти десять минут постарел на десяток лет, а волосы еще молодого парня, точно оптоволокно, посеребрила седина.

— И что теперь? — осипшим от волнения голосом спросил у Дима товарищ.

— Давай пожрем! Пожрем, как в последний раз! — расслабившись, облокотился на кресло Дим. Говорят, до Последней войны, приговоренным давали такую возможность, — ни нервов, ни уж тем более сил на переживания у Дима уже не было.

Он сделал всё, что мог, отдал всего себя без остатка этому боту. И переживать уже был просто не в состоянии.

— Всё готово? — Рос Пер разбудил задремавшего Дима. Ром в это время находился в кабине и отчаянно пытался привести в движение боевой бот.

— Ага, — коротко ответил Дим, так и не открывая глаз. — Только он не движется. Заводится, полностью функционирует, связь между системами налажена, но бот не желает повторять движения пилота.

— И ты так расслаблен? — ухмыльнулся начальник цитадели.

— Легат, за последние пять дней я спал чуть больше двадцати часов. Да, я пытался, и признаюсь, что у меня не вышло. Я бы мог попросить ещё времени, но это было бы глупо: если я и допустил где-то ошибку, то не по причине халатности, а по незнанию тонкостей какой-то конкретной системы. При всем желании исправить её я не смогу, так что дайте хоть в последние минуты в своей жизни подремать.

— Да ты фаталист, боец, — Влад Раж пнул основание кресла так, что оно перевернулось — Сложная ли система управления у твоей машины?

Дим нехотя сел на пол:

— За основу была взята система с экзоскелета, интерфейс был написан простой, но там только скелет, так что запутаться в дополнительных функциях не получится.

Влад Раж кивнул и трусцой побежал к тыльной стороне ноги Шерхана, туда, где простые металлические скобы были приварены вместо лестницы. Готового трапа в арсенале не имелось.

Бот, работающий на холостых оборотах, вдруг заревел допотопными топливными двигателями, сделал неуверенный шаг и повернулся к Рос Перу с Димом. Кабина пилотов размещалась в грудной клетке. Место головы занимал моторный отсек в сверхзащищенном корпусе.